RESUMO
The purpose of this study is to compare rapid prototyping models created from cone beam computerized tomography (CBCT) and multislice computerized tomography (CT) data, in order to verify the accuracy of these technologies. A dry skull mandible was submitted in a CBCT (NewTom ? QR, Italy) and CT (Select SP-Elscint, Israel) exams. The tomographies data were processed by two different Medical Image processing systems, 3D-Analyze (Mayo Clinic, U.S.A.) and InVesalius (CenPRA, Brazil). Rapid prototypes models were built in two different rapid prototyping technologies, 3D Printer (3DP) and Selective Laser Sintering (SLS). The dry skull mandible (gold standard) and the eight prototypes, as follows; I-CT-Analyze?3DP; IICT- Invesalius?3DP; III-CT-Analyze?SLS; IV-CT-Invesalius-SLS; V-CBCT-Analyze? 3DP; VI-CBCT-Invesalius?3DP; VIII-CBCT-Analyze?SLS; VIII-CBCT-Invesalius-SLS, were submitted to a reverse engineering process aimed to digitalize the surfaces of the objects to compare each rapid prototype model with the gold standard with a precision of 0.001mm. Percentage deviations errors until 1.0mm and 2.0mm were calculated, compared and statistically analyzed. The prototyped models obtained with multislice computerized tomography data shows more accuracy than those obtained with data from cone beam computerized tomography.
